- 하이브리드 연료전지차량에 있어서,하나의 메인버스단을 공유하며, 서로 병렬로 연결된 복수의 주동력원;휠을 구동시키기 위해 상기 메인버스단으로부터 전원을 공급받아 출력토크를 발생하며, 서로 병렬로 연결된 복수의 구동계;상기 주동력원의 파워부족분을 보충하기 위해 주동력원과 구동계 사이에 설치되며, 상기 메인버스단을 공유하는 보조동력원;을 포함하여 구성되고상기 복수의 구동계는 복수개의 모터를 포함하고, 상기 메인버스단의 동력이 인버터를 통해 상기 모터에 각각 독립적으로 공급되며,상기 구동계에서 출력된 출력토크를 휠에 일정한 기어비로 증대시키기 위해 복수개의 모터를 병합하는 기어수단을 더 포함하며,상기 기어수단은, 상기 복수개의 모터가 적어도 3개의 모터로 구성될 때, 3개의 모터 모두가 동일한 토크 증대비를 갖도록 2개 모터의 출력축이 입력으로 직결되고, 다른 하나의 모터가 감속기어부(RGU)를 통해 병합되는 동력연결장치(PCD); 및상기 PCD의 최종 출력축을 기어차동부(GDU)에 연결해 주는 유니버셜 조인트를 포함하는 것을 특징으로 하는 멀티동력원 및 멀티구동계를 갖는 하이브리드 연료전지차량.
- 청구항 6에 있어서,상기 RGU는 유성기어의 조합으로 이루어지고, 제2모터의 출력축은 RGU의 선기어에 연결되며, 링기어가 고정되고, 캐리어축은 PCD와 결합된 상태로 캐리어를 통해 제2모터의 토크가 증대되는 구조로 설치되는 것을 특징으로 하는 멀티동력원 및 멀티구동계를 갖는 하이브리드 연료전지차량.
